Wedding of the Duke of Kent and Princess Marina.
The Royal wedding cake, by McVitie and Price, 9 feet high and weighing some 800 lbs, the four tiers are separated by solid silver pillars, its style semi grecian

This photograph captures the grandeur of the Wedding of the Duke of Kent and Princess Marina. The focal point is undoubtedly the magnificent Royal wedding cake, proudly created by McVitie and Price. Standing an impressive 9 feet tall and weighing a staggering 800 lbs, this masterpiece is a true testament to craftsmanship. The four tiers of the cake are elegantly separated by solid silver pillars, adding a touch of regal sophistication to its semi-Grecian style.
